Icelandic experimental band Sigur Rós are posting their music documentary online. Their website states:

this friday, march the 7th, sigur rós will be taking over the front page of youtube for the day. the band will take over all twelve slots on the sites home page and the centrepiece of this will be “heima” in full. this is the first time a full-length music documentary is available to view on youtube.

aswell as “heima”, the ten best entries of the “minn heima” youtube / sigur rós competition will be shown on the home page in addition to a special message from the band themselves.

I saw “Heima” a few months ago and wrote a review for this blog - the film is incredible. Ideally you should watch this film on a high quality DVD, however it’s hard to find, so you might just have to settle for YouTube. So if you are a lover of all things movie and music, it’s definitely a must-see. I imagine your best bet is to log onto the British YouTube mainpage tomorrow @ http://uk.youtube.com.
